Petr Petrov struggled to regain his footing, his head pounding from the lingering effects of the zinc gas. As he blinked the world back into focus, the chaotic scene of the battlefield came into sharp relief. His teammates were in the thick of it, desperately trying to fend off Darwin Dawson's relentless onslaught.

Darwin moved with a fluid, almost dance-like grace, his smirk never wavering as he stopped time in ten-second bursts, leaving the Power Patrol scrambling to keep up. Henry's armor was now at 95%, but even that seemed insufficient against Darwin's overwhelming power.

"Come on, is that all you've got?" Darwin taunted, reappearing behind Sandra and landing a vicious blow to her back. She cried out in pain, her telekinetic barrier shattering.

Steve unleashed a powerful sonic blast, the sound waves distorting the air as they hurtled toward Darwin. But the time manipulator effortlessly sidestepped the attack, freezing time just long enough to reappear beside Steve and land a crushing punch to his ribs.

"You'll have to do better than that, rock star," Darwin sneered, his eyes gleaming with amusement.

Himari, using his enhanced speed and reflexes, managed to land a few solid hits on Darwin, but each time he thought he had the upper hand, Darwin would stop time and counterattack, leaving Himari reeling.

"We need a plan!" Henry shouted, his voice strained as he blocked another of Darwin's strikes. "Something to exploit his weakness!"

"He's too fast," Sandra gasped, clutching her side where Darwin had struck her. "We can't predict where he'll be next."

Petr, his strength slowly returning, staggered to his feet. "Then we need to limit his movement," he said through gritted teeth. "Force him into a position where he can't dodge."

Steve nodded, his mind racing. "Sandra, can you create a telekinetic field around us? Make it tight enough that he can't easily escape."

Sandra nodded, her face pale but determined. She raised her hands, concentrating hard, and a shimmering barrier began to form around the team, enclosing them and Darwin in a confined space.

Darwin laughed, the sound echoing eerily off the barrier. "You think this will stop me? Adorable."

But even as he spoke, Henry saw a flicker of uncertainty in Darwin's eyes. They were getting to him. "Everyone, focus your attacks on him now!" Henry shouted, his armor glowing brighter.

The team moved in unison. Steve fired a concentrated sonic blast, Himari launched a flurry of punches, and Sandra used her telekinesis to hurl debris at Darwin. Petr, now fully on his feet, charged with a roar, his fists ready to deliver crushing blows.

For a moment, it seemed like they might overwhelm him. Darwin's movements became more frantic, his time-stopping intervals shorter and more desperate. But he was still a formidable opponent, and he managed to evade the worst of their attacks, landing brutal counterstrikes that left the team battered and bleeding.

Henry's armor now glowed with an intense light, signaling that he was at 99%. He took a deep breath, pushing through the pain and exhaustion. "One more push!" he yelled. "We can do this!"

With a final, unified effort, the Power Patrol converged on Darwin, forcing him into a corner of the telekinetic barrier. He looked around, realizing too late that he had nowhere left to run.

As Henry's armor hit 100%, he felt a surge of power like never before. "This ends now!" he roared, launching himself at Darwin with all his might.

The chapter ended with a blinding flash of light as Henry's attack connected, leaving the outcome uncertain. The fight was far from over, but the Power Patrol had proven they could stand together against even the most formidable foes.
